Technical Versatility and high Accuracy of the A11VO Structure

The advantage of an A11VO variable displacement pump lies within the ability to adjust the fluid output flow dependent on the specific pressure demands of the circuit. By altering the position of the swashplate, the actuator is able to modulate the stroke length of the the pistons, leading to massive power savings and high reduced thermal generation. The precise management is vital in modern equipment which requires dynamic speed and high rotational forces. As a extremely dependable A11VO pump, it is capable of managing managing both open and also sealed circuit setups, offering supreme flexibility to hydraulic designers worldwide.

To cater to different size requirements of industrial machinery, the A11VO40 / A11VO60 / A11VO75 / A11VO95 / A11VO130 / A11VO145 / A11VO190 / A11VO260 product range offers the wide spectrum of displacement volume capacities. Whether the task demands for a compact displacement unit and the massive 260cc drive, there stays a precise variant available to match meet the power profile. Every version within the large catalog shares the core concepts of rugged design and high elevated working reliability. The standardization across the series eases the sourcing procurement of spare parts, ensuring that service technicians are able to rapidly find the necessary seals, groups, and high bearings demanded to keep their equipment operating optimally.
